Abstract
In this study, fibronectin and sialic acid levels have been assayed in human meningiomas and gliomas. The mean fibronectin and sialic acid levels for human meningiomas were 22.01 ± 9.70 μg/mg protein and 19.58 ± 4.89 μg/mg protein, respectively, and for human gliomas were 27.30 ± 13.70 μg/mg protein and 25.67 ± 11.60 μg/mg protein, respectively, versus 9.23 ± 5.40 μg/mg protein and 13.50 ± 4.30 μg/mg protein for normal brain tissues. Fibronectin and sialic acid levels were significantly higher in human meningiomas (P < 0.01 and P < 0.05) and gliomas (P < 0.001 and P < 0.01) than control group. Also the mean fibronectin and sialic acid levels were found to be 18.27 ± 7.08 μg/mg protein and 17.04 ± 6.25 μg/mg protein in Grade I–II and 32.60 ± 15.00 μg/mg protein ad 29.50 ± 11.60 μg/mg protein in Grade III–IV gliomas, respectively. Fibronectin and sialic acid levels were significantly higher in Grade III–IV gliomas than Grade I–II gliomas (P < 0.05).
